HTTP: Microsoft Windows CVE-2016-0058 Remote Code Execution

This signature detects attempts to exploit a known vulnerability against Microsoft Windows PDF Library. A successful attack can lead to Remote Code Execution.

Extended Description

Buffer overflow in the PDF Library in Microsoft Windows 8.1, Windows Server 2012 Gold and R2, and Windows 10 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ted PDF document that triggers API calls, aka "Microsoft PDF Library Buffer Overflow Vulnerability."
